MC, 2025
Ilustracja do artykułu: Gnuplot Kontúrvonal Ábra Készítés: Teljes Útmutató Kezdőknek és Haladóknak

Gnuplot Kontúrvonal Ábra Készítés: Teljes Útmutató Kezdőknek és Haladóknak

A Gnuplot egy rendkívül erőteljes és sokoldalú grafikus eszköz, amely segít adatok vizualizálásában. Az egyik legnépszerűbb ábra, amit a Gnuplot segítségével készíthetünk, a kontúrvonal ábra (contour plot). Ez az ábra különösen hasznos, ha háromdimenziós adatokat szeretnénk kétdimenziós felületen megjeleníteni, úgy, hogy a különböző adatértékek szintjeit egy-egy vonallal jelezzük. Ebben a cikkben részletesen bemutatjuk a Gnuplot kontúrvonal ábra készítésének lépéseit, és megosztunk néhány hasznos példát is, hogy könnyedén el tudja készíteni saját ábráit!

Miért Érdemes Kontúrvonal Ábrát Készíteni?

Kontúrvonal ábrák akkor hasznosak, amikor szeretnénk háromdimenziós adatokat kétdimenziós síkon megjeleníteni. Például, ha egy függvényt ábrázolunk, amelynek értékei különböző magasságokkal rendelkeznek, a kontúrvonal ábra lehetővé teszi számunkra, hogy ezeket a magasságokat szintvonalakként jelenítsük meg. A Gnuplot segítségével könnyedén készíthetünk kontúrvonal ábrákat, amelyek segítenek az adatok elemzésében és azok vizualizálásában.

1. Gnuplot Telepítése

Ahhoz, hogy elkezdhesse használni a Gnuplot-ot, először telepítenie kell a számítógépére. A Gnuplot telepítése egyszerű, és különböző operációs rendszerekhez elérhető. Az alábbiakban bemutatjuk, hogyan telepítheti a Gnuplot-ot Windows, Linux és macOS rendszeren.

Windows:

Windows rendszeren látogasson el a Gnuplot hivatalos weboldalára, és töltse le a legfrissebb verziót. A telepítés egyszerű: futtassa a letöltött fájlt, és kövesse az utasításokat.

Linux:

Linux rendszeren a Gnuplot telepítése a csomagkezelő segítségével történik. Az alábbi parancsokkal telepítheti:

sudo apt-get update
sudo apt-get install gnuplot

macOS:

macOS rendszeren használhatja a Homebrew csomagkezelőt. Ha még nincs telepítve, először telepítse a Homebrew-t, majd futtassa az alábbi parancsot:

brew install gnuplot

Miután telepítette a Gnuplot-ot, készen áll arra, hogy kontúrvonal ábrákat készítsen.

2. Kontúrvonal Ábra Alapjai

A kontúrvonal ábra készítése előtt fontos, hogy tisztában legyünk az alapvető Gnuplot parancsokkal. A Gnuplotban az adatokat általában egy fájlban tároljuk, és a parancsokat használjuk az ábra megjelenítésére. A kontúrvonal ábrák esetében a legfontosabb parancsok a következők:

set contour
splot 'adatok.dat' with lines

Az első parancs engedélyezi a kontúrvonal ábrát, a második pedig megjeleníti az adatokat egy háromdimenziós felületen. Az alábbiakban bemutatunk egy egyszerű példát, amely segít megérteni, hogyan működik a kontúrvonal ábra.

3. Példa Kontúrvonal Ábra Készítésére

Tegyük fel, hogy van egy adatfájlunk, amely a következő adatokat tartalmazza:

# x, y, z
0 0 0
1 0 1
2 0 4
0 1 1
1 1 2
2 1 3
0 2 4
1 2 3
2 2 1

Ez egy egyszerű mátrix, amely az x, y és z koordinátákat tartalmazza. A Gnuplot segítségével könnyedén készíthetünk kontúrvonal ábrát a következő parancsokkal:

set contour
splot 'adatok.dat' with lines

Ez a parancs megjeleníti a kontúrvonalakat, amelyeket az adatok alapján számít ki. Az ábra a következőképpen fog kinézni: a vonalak különböző szinteken jelölik az adat értékeit. Ez segít az adatok elemzésében, és könnyen láthatjuk, hogy hol vannak a magasabb és alacsonyabb értékek.

4. Kontúrvonal Ábrák Testreszabása

A Gnuplot lehetővé teszi, hogy testreszabja a kontúrvonal ábrát, hogy az jobban illeszkedjen a kívánt vizualizációs célokhoz. Itt van néhány módja annak, hogyan teheti szebbé és informatívabbá az ábrát:

Színek Beállítása:

A színek hozzáadása segít kiemelni a különböző adatértékeket. Például, ha szeretné, hogy a kontúrvonalak különböző színekkel jelenjenek meg, használhatja a következő parancsot:

set palette model RGB defined (0 "blue", 1 "red", 2 "yellow")
splot 'adatok.dat' with lines

Ez a parancs beállítja a színeket, és minden szintvonal más színt kap. A színek testreszabása segít a vizualizáció tisztábbá és érthetőbbé tételében.

Kontúrvonalak Tömörítése:

Ha túl sok kontúrvonalat szeretne megjeleníteni, és azok túl zsúfoltnak tűnnek, csökkentheti a vonalak számát a következő parancsokkal:

set cntrparam levels incremental 0, 1, 10
splot 'adatok.dat' with lines

Ez a parancs beállítja, hogy a kontúrvonalak csak a 0, 1 és 10 értékekhez legyenek kiszámítva, így elkerülhetjük a túl sok vonalat.

5. További Tippek és Trükkök

A Gnuplot rendkívül sokoldalú eszköz, és rengeteg lehetőséget kínál a vizualizációk testreszabására. Néhány további tipp:

  • Ha több adatot szeretne ábrázolni, használja a 'multiple splot' parancsot, hogy egyszerre több adatforrást jeleníthessen meg.
  • A Gnuplot támogatja az animációk készítését is, amelyeket kontúrvonal ábrák esetén is használhat.
  • Használjon címkéket (labels), hogy az ábra még informatívabb legyen, és könnyen felismerhetőek legyenek az egyes szintek.

Párosítva A Gnuplot-tal

Ha szeretné továbbfejleszteni a Gnuplot használatát, próbálja ki más grafikus funkciókat, például a 3D-s felületek vagy az adatpontok kirajzolását. A Gnuplot kiválóan alkalmas arra, hogy összetett tudományos adatokat vizualizáljon és elemezzen.

Komentarze (0) - Nikt jeszcze nie komentował - bądź pierwszy!

Imię:
Treść: